At work one afternoon, I received an email regarding our annual 2009 School Supply program. This SRE program was created in order to provide school supplies for needy children in the Akron area. School supply-backpack kits donations are made to a variety of charitable non-profit organizations such as Salvation Army, Central Baptist Mission Center, and Harvest Home @ Haven of Rest. Because of my affiliation with FBC and our Outreach Ministry, the Harvest Home a division of Haven of Rest really burden my heart. Upon further research I discovered, Haven of Rest Ministries opened Harvest Home in 1979 in response to the growing need for an emergency shelter for women and children in crisis situations. While staying at Harvest Home, all receive the security in the knowledge that they are loved and important to God. Because many of its residents are single mothers with young children, many kids struggle to receive the needed supplies required to receiving a good education. So, I took my money and tripled the amount and donated it towards this worthy program. In addition, we were recently told that the owner of SRE will match our donation. (All ready a blessing!). So, God's money has been blessed over six times and now a larger number of children will receive a good education, regardless of their financial situation.

We prayed for God to show us how to use this money that had been given to us and we both felt that it should be used to be a blessing for someone in ourcommunity. As some of you know our neighbor has been diagnosed with pancreatic cancer. She had surgery but they were not able to remove thetumor, so she will be under going radiation and chemo in hopes to shrink it.Her husband has a very long commute to work and usually doesn't come home until the weekend. We noticed that he's been traveling back and forth a lot more now so we decided that we would help them out with gas. We added some money and purchased a gift card for gas and gave them a card letting them know that our church was praying for them and that we care about them.
